First and foremost, low interest credit cards offer significant savings. With a lower interest rate, you can save a considerable amount of money over time compared to higher interest rate credit cards. For instance, if you have a balance of $5,000 on your credit card with an interest rate of 20%, and you only make the minimum payment each month, it could take you up to 8 years to pay off the debt. However, with a low interest rate of 10%, you can save hundreds or even thousands of dollars in interest and pay off the balance sooner.

Another benefit of low interest credit cards is the ability to transfer balances and consolidate debt. Many low interest credit cards offer balance transfer options, allowing you to transfer the balance from a high-interest credit card to the new low interest one. This can help you save money on interest and simplify your debt by having it in one place. However, it is important to note that there is usually a fee for balance transfers, so make sure to read the terms and conditions before making the switch.
